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7517789 30370 8877848 42
45898890268 901399300 741982
45898890268 901399300 741982
415730177 1034 21
All about undefined
Interested in learning more?
45898890268 901399300 741982
415730177 1034 21
See more
692503838 9030
62446051728 292 0030 75156378345
See more
98382462151 85538170
3208100775 6838723 200703 960
See more